Problem

Conventional mobile devices can only control one speaker at a time and require manual selection of external speakers for audio signal output, lacking an efficient method to manage multiple speakers connected to the same network.

Innovation Solution

A mobile device with an audio processor, outputter, communicator, and controller that processes audio signals, transmits them to external speakers via a network, and allows for selection, grouping, and volume adjustment of multiple speakers using a user interface, enabling seamless audio signal distribution and control across multiple speakers.

AI summary

A mobile device including an audio processor processing audio data and generating an audio signal, an outputter outputting the audio signal, a communicator that may be connected to an AP (Access Point) network, and a controller, in response to a predetermined event occurring with the audio signal being output, transmitting the audio signal to an external speaker included in the AP network through the communicator and controlling the external speaker to output the audio signal.
